The Homecare Administrator/Coordinator will oversee the efficient delivery of homecare services to clients, ensuring high-quality care and compliance with regulations. This role involves:
- Recruiting and scheduling carers
- Managing client records
- Coordinating care calls and care plans
- Acting as a point of contact for clients and staff
The ideal candidate is organised, detail-oriented, and has excellent communication and problem-solving skills as well as IT skills. Experience in care is essential and must have a current driving licence.

We think this is how you could land Homecare Administrator/Coordinator
✨Tip Number 1
Familiarise yourself with the latest regulations and standards in homecare services. This knowledge will not only help you during interviews but also demonstrate your commitment to providing high-quality care.
✨Tip Number 2
Network with professionals in the homecare industry. Attend local events or join online forums where you can connect with others in the field. This can lead to valuable insights and potential job referrals.
✨Tip Number 3
Showcase your organisational skills by preparing a mock schedule for carers or a sample care plan. Presenting these during an interview can highlight your proactive approach and understanding of the role.
✨Tip Number 4
Brush up on your IT skills, especially any software commonly used in homecare management. Being proficient in these tools can set you apart from other candidates and show that you're ready to hit the ground running.

How to prepare for a job interview at CV-Library
✨Showcase Your Organisational Skills
As a Homecare Administrator/Coordinator, being organised is key.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you successfully managed schedules or coordinated care plans. This will demonstrate your ability to handle the responsibilities of the role.
✨Highlight Your Communication Skills
Effective communication is crucial in this position. Be ready to discuss how you've effectively communicated with clients and staff in previous roles. Consider sharing specific instances where your communication skills helped resolve issues or improve service delivery.
✨Demonstrate Problem-Solving Abilities
Employers are looking for candidates who can think on their feet. Prepare to discuss challenges you've faced in the care sector and how you overcame them. This will show your potential employer that you can handle the unexpected with ease.
✨Familiarise Yourself with Regulations
Understanding compliance and regulations in homecare is essential. Brush up on relevant laws and standards before the interview. Being knowledgeable about these aspects will show your commitment to providing high-quality care and your readiness for the role.
